Institut CourtoisThe Institut Courtois was created at the Université de Montréal in 2022 by an historic gift of $159M from the Foundation Courtois to accelerate the discovery of new materials. The donation is the largest ever made in Canada for academic research in the physical sciences. The gift will allow expansion of the Complexe des sciences on Campus MIL and help fund a world-class center in which specialists in chemistry, physics, computation, robotics, artificial intelligence, and other areas will work together to lead materials science in productive new directions.
